To solve for \( f \) in the equation

\[
9f = \frac{1}{2}(12f - 2),
\]

we first eliminate the fraction by multiplying both sides by 2:

\[
2 \cdot 9f = 12f - 2.
\]

This simplifies to:

\[
18f = 12f - 2.
\]

Next, we will isolate \( f \) by moving the term \( 12f \) to the left side of the equation:

\[
18f - 12f = -2.
\]

This simplifies to:

\[
6f = -2.
\]

Now, divide both sides by 6 to solve for \( f \):

\[
f = \frac{-2}{6} = \frac{-1}{3}.
\]

Thus, the exact answer is

\[
\boxed{-\frac{1}{3}}.
\]
